Abstract

Distribution Transformers are one of the most important equipment in power system network. Distribution transformer failures can be broadly categorized due to electrical and/or mechanical faults. Preventive diagnosis and maintenance of transformer have become more and more popular in recent time in order to improve the reliability of electric power system. It is experienced by the power utility engineers that the distribution transformer failure occurs mainly due to overload condition and improper cooling agent (oil) level in distribution transformer. This paper presents Capacitance Model which is developed by taking actual data of the distribution transformer connected in Maharashtra State Electricity Distribution Company Limited (MSEDCL). The oil leakage problem in terms of oil level in distribution transformer can be detected by developing capacitance modeling as well as by Newton's cooling law.
